Assessing Lawyer Experience
When selecting a criminal defense lawyer, examining their experience is essential. You'll want to dive deep right into their past situations to comprehend not simply the amount of situations they've managed, however the high quality of outcomes accomplished.
It's not almost how long they have actually been practicing, but how well they have actually dealt with instances similar to your own. Seek specifics: Have they dealt with charges like yours before? How many of those cases went to trial, and what were the outcomes?
It's vital you recognize they've got a strong performance history with successful outcomes in situations comparable to what you're facing. Experience in a court is specifically important if your situation goes to trial. You don't simply desire someone who knows the regulation; you need somebody that maneuvers efficiently within the court characteristics.

Examining Interaction Skills
Assessing communication abilities is essential when choosing a criminal defense attorney. You'll want a person who not just speaks clearly however additionally pays attention successfully. Your attorney needs to make you really feel comprehended and make sure that you realize every aspect of your situation.
Try to find a legal representative who can discuss intricate lawful terms in straightforward language. They must be approachable, making it very easy for you to ask concerns and share problems. Notification just how they interact during your first assessment. Are they individual? Do they offer in-depth solutions or rush with descriptions?
Great communication additionally indicates staying in touch. Your lawyer needs to update you consistently concerning your instance's progression. Check if they choose e-mails, call, or face-to-face conferences and see if their favored technique lines up with your requirements.
Last but not least, consider their ability to communicate under pressure. Court setups are high-stress environments, and you require someone who can articulate your defense clearly and well before a judge and jury.
Request for instances of just how they've dealt with difficult cases or situations in the past.
Understanding Protection Techniques
Understanding the different defense techniques your lawyer may employ is important to effectively navigating your case. Each method rests on the specifics of the fees you're encountering and the evidence against you. Let's explore what bronx criminal lawyer need to know.
First of all, if there's a lack of evidence, your lawyer may argue that the prosecution hasn't met its burden of proof. Keep in mind, it's not your work to confirm virtue; it's the district attorney's job to confirm shame beyond an affordable question. If they can't, you need to be acquitted.
One more typical strategy is self-defense, specifically in cases involving charges like assault or homicide. If you were securing on your own, your lawyer might use this method to justify your activities legitimately. This calls for confirming that your perception of threat was reasonable and that your reaction was proportional to that threat.
Often, your protection might entail wondering about the legitimacy of exactly how proof was gotten. If police violated your civil liberties during the examination, proof may be suppressed, which can dramatically deteriorate the prosecution's situation.
Ultimately, your attorney could negotiate an appeal deal if it offers your best interest. This normally happens if the proof against you is solid but there are alleviating variables that might cause decreased costs or sentencing.
Understanding these strategies aids you review your instance more effectively with your lawyer.
